Cultural & Leadership Insights from the Far East
Martin Johnson speaks to Spencer Locker following his recent trip to Malaysia where he delivered a Leadership development programme for a global Plc. Spencer shares his observations on their efficiency and focus and talks about how it differs to Western cultures.

Zanshin - Falling in love with Boredom, Process and Monotony!
Martin Johnson speaks to Spencer Locker about the ancient Japanese concept of Zanshin (The art of attention and focus) where the mind is fully vigilant and aware of its surroundings. Featured both in training of Samurai Archers and Zen, Zanshin is linked to marginal gains and the power of repetition. But how can this be of an advantage to us in the workplace?
